gpt4 book ai didi

java - 如何使用最新版本的 JDK 构建和运行?

转载 作者:行者123 更新时间:2023-11-30 05:18:15 27 4
gpt4 key购买 nike

Bazel 正在下载并使用旧的 Java 11.0.1。已有five releases of Java 11 with security updates从那时起。

我可以make Bazel use my local JDK但这有明显的缺点。

如何使用安全的最新版本 JDK 进行构建?

最佳答案

我根本不相信这是必要的。 (请参阅我对该问题的评论。)

但是,如果您确实想更改 Bazel 的内置 Java,您可以采用以下方法之一:

  1. 按照 Contributing to Bazel 中的说明进行操作页。请注意,您需要安装 Bazel 才能构建 Bazel。我假设您可以(以某种方式)选择嵌入“可分发”中的 Java ...或者由它下载的 Java,如果发生这种情况的话。
  2. 有一个“compile.sh”文件可能可以作为替代方案。 (我没有仔细看。)
  3. 您可以按照正常方式下载并安装 Bazel,然后调整安装以将嵌入式 Java 替换为您想要的任何内容。例如,尝试使用系统 Java 安装的符号链接(symbolic link)替换其内部 Java 安装树,并使用 Linux 包管理器保持最新状态。

关于java - 如何使用最新版本的 JDK 构建和运行?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59998824/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com